Output 8f50d8c2fdb86e8849f460175bc572c819d117d697d033d986aab17c0b654dfd:0

value
28528317
script pubkey
OP_0 OP_PUSHBYTES_20 2ccf4c93edb65ab07c6640d8299bfbf709c7601e
address
bc1q9n85eyldkedtqlrxgrvznxlm7uyuwcq776dkh9
transaction
8f50d8c2fdb86e8849f460175bc572c819d117d697d033d986aab17c0b654dfd
confirmations
129099
spent
true